The prosecutor was taken on Thursday morning all accused For the assassination of the 43 -year -old Polish professor, which took place on July 4 in Agia Paraskevi.
The former wife of the victim is accused of being a moral perpetrator of his murder and her current companion as the homicide.
At the same time, 3 more people, two of Albanian descent and one Bulgarian, allegedly helped the perpetrator and accused of synergy. They, according to data so far, have transferred the perpetrator to the crime scene and allegedly given the gun.

The four men they are alleged to have confess to the authorities and have described the role Everyone had in the execution of the crime, however, the professor’s ex -husband allegedly denied the charges, although there are important evidence against her.
In the question of why the 43 -year -old was murdered, reports say that everything started after decision Court that allowed the professor to take the two his children abroad.
The ex -husband allegedly discussing her partner in a way of give a solution on the issue, while it appears that with each other besides the custody of the children, their It also broke up a dispute for financial differences They had two companies that had set up together in America when they were a couple.
It is recalled that the 43 -year -old was found dead shortly after 4pm on Friday, July 4, on Irini Street in Agia Paraskevi, with bullet wounds in the chest and neck.
According to testimonies, the perpetrator, who appears to be the current companion of his ex -wife, 43 -year -old’s wife, a worn surgical mask, approached the 43 -year -old and shot him. Officers collected 5 caps from the crime scene.
